Yggdrasil YG Masters welcomes Skyrocket Entertainment’s The Games Company to the program
Several online gaming content companies have been joining the reputable YG Masters program of Yggdrasil as of late with the most recent being the Skyrocket Entertainment company. The group will now have access ...